Milling Work Expected To Begin On Alabama Highway 9 On Tuesday

Contract workers are expected to begin milling work on Tuesday (February, 2nd, 2021) on Alabama Highway 9 (the Causeway) between Centre and Cedar Bluff, weather permitting, according to Seth Burkett Public Information for the North Division of the Alabama Department of Transportation.

The project is about five miles long and goes from the south end of the Burnett Bridge over the Coosa River on Alabama 9 at Cedar Bluff to the Alabama 68 intersection (Cedar Bluff Road at Armory Road), north of U.S. 411 in Centre.

Motorists should be prepared for single-lane closures, expect delays, and plan for additional travel time. The majority of the project is only a two-lane highway, so when the contractor is milling and paving through that area, traffic will be reduced to one lane controlled by flaggers or pilot car. Weather permitting; the time-frame may be several weeks of actual paving. ALDOT says that they anticipate the project being essentially complete before the end of the year.
